Justine Jones has lived her life as a fearful hypochondriac until she's lured into the web of a mysterious mastermind named Packard. He gifts her with extraordinary mental powers-dooming her to fight Midcity's shadowy war on paranormal crime in order to find the peace she so desperately craves.
But now, serial killers with unheard-of skills are terrorizing the most powerful beings in Midcity, including mastermind Packard - and his oldest friend and worst enemy, Midcity's new mayor, who has the ability to bend matter itself to his will.
As the body count grows, Justine faces a crisis of conscience as she tests the limits of her new powers and faces an impossible choice between two flawed but brilliant men . . . one on a journey of redemption, and the other descending into a pit of moral depravity.

When I finally finished Double Cross only three words came to mind: OH MY G-D! I was seriously in shock at how this book ended and I did consider stalking Carolyn until she told me what the hell was she thinking when she wrote it and how was she going to fix it.
Double Cross starts a few months after the events of Mind Games, our girl Justine is happily working on her normal relationship with now mayor, Otto Sanchez, and she continues to work for Packard even though she is still trying to find a way out of being his minion.
I am really trying to come up with a way to talk about Double Cross without spoiling anything, but it is really hard. Carolyn takes her world to places never gone before and she changes the whole games with the events in this book.
Justine goes through the ringer and things will never be the same after all that she has been through. We meet new characters, new and creepy highcap powers and the action is non stop. A story full of twists and turns that will leave you dizzy and craving for your next fix. The problems I had with abrupt chapter endings are over in Double Cross, so I can honestly say this is an amazing book and I am dying to get my hands on the next one.
Carolyn Crane’s creation is a must read for any Urban Fantasy reader out there. If you haven’t checked out this series yet, what the heck is the matter with you? Seriously!
